Forex Expert Advisor Generator: Pros, Cons & Alternatives
The appeal of a Forex Expert Advisor (EA) generator is undeniable – the promise of effortless trading strategies can be incredibly enticing to both inexperienced traders and experienced professionals. However, these programs are far from a silver bullet . We'll the advantages and downsides before diving into some other approaches. Positively , generators can greatly minimize the time needed to develop an EA, maybe letting traders to test multiple concepts quickly. Furthermore , they can occasionally offer a simplified interface for those lacking coding skills . But, a crucial concern is that most generated EAs are poorly optimized and frequently result in losses . The lack of genuine trading logic means they can be readily exploited by price conditions.
- Pros: Speedy EA development, Potential for trial , Simplified interface.
- Cons: Low trading effectiveness , Risk of considerable poor results, Trust on a unknown process .

Unlocking Profits: How Forex Expert Advisors Work
Forex expert systems, often shortened to EAs, offer a attractive way to create possible profits in the foreign exchange market. These complex applications are essentially digital programs designed to automatically execute deal-making strategies based on pre-defined guidelines. Instead of personally monitoring price fluctuations and placing orders, an EA can evaluate information 24/7, spotting chances that a trader might miss.
Here’s how they generally function:
- Strategy Implementation: The EA is coded with a specific deal-making strategy. This method dictates when to buy or liquidate currencies.
- Market Analysis: EAs utilize signals – like price trends and Relative Strength Index – to evaluate exchange conditions.
- Order Execution: When the pre-set conditions are met, the EA independently places acquire or dispose of trades.
- Risk Control: Many EAs include danger control features such as risk limit orders to limit possible losses.
While EAs can provide the hope of automated income, it's essential to appreciate that they are not a guarantee of success and require careful study and oversight.
